Azure Blob Storage
Basic Operations
async def test_upload_blob(absc, mock_azureblob):
container_client, mock_blob_client, set_return = mock_azureblob
# Configure expected upload response
set_return.upload_blob_returns({"status": "uploaded"})
# Test upload
result = await absc.upload_blob("test.txt", b"content")
assert result == {"status": "uploaded"}
async def test_download_blob(absc, mock_azureblob):
container_client, mock_blob_client, set_return = mock_azureblob
# Configure download response
set_return.download_blob_returns(b"file content")
# Test download
content = await absc.download_blob("test.txt")
assert content == b"file content"
async def test_list_blobs(absc, mock_azureblob):
from azure.storage.blob import BlobProperties
container_client, mock_blob_client, set_return = mock_azureblob
# Configure list response
mock_blobs = [
BlobProperties(name="file1.txt", size=100),
BlobProperties(name="file2.txt", size=200),
]
set_return.list_blobs_returns(mock_blobs)
# Test listing
blobs = [blob async for blob in absc.list_blobs()]
assert len(blobs) == 2
assert blobs[0].name == "file1.txt"
SAS Token Generation
async def test_sas_token(absc, mock_azureblob, mocksas):
mockgen, fake_token = mocksas
container_client, mock_blob_client, _ = mock_azureblob
mock_blob_client.account_name = "teststorage"
# Test token generation
token = await absc.get_blob_sas_token("test.txt")
assert token == fake_token
async def test_sas_url(absc, mock_azureblob, mocksas):
mockgen, fake_token = mocksas
container_client, mock_blob_client, _ = mock_azureblob
mock_blob_client.account_name = "teststorage"
# Test URL generation
url = await absc.get_blob_sas_url("test.txt")
assert fake_token in url
assert "test.txt" in url
Cosmos DB
Document Operations
async def test_create_document(cosmos_insertable):
container_client, set_return = cosmos_insertable
test_doc = {"id": "test-1", "name": "Test Document"}
set_return(test_doc)
result = await container_client.create_item(body=test_doc)
assert result == test_doc
async def test_read_document(cosmos_readable):
container_client, set_return = cosmos_readable
expected = {"id": "test-1", "name": "Test Document"}
set_return(expected)
result = await container_client.read_item(item="test-1", partition_key="test-1")
assert result == expected
async def test_update_document(cosmos_updatable):
container_client, set_return = cosmos_updatable
updated_doc = {"id": "test-1", "name": "Updated Document"}
set_return(updated_doc)
result = await container_client.replace_item(item="test-1", body=updated_doc)
assert result == updated_doc
async def test_delete_document(cosmos_deletable):
container_client, set_return = cosmos_deletable
set_return(None)
await container_client.delete_item(item="test-1", partition_key="test-1")
# No exception means success
Query Operations
async def test_query_documents(cosmos_queryable):
container_client, set_return = cosmos_queryable
expected_docs = [
{"id": "1", "name": "Doc 1"},
{"id": "2", "name": "Doc 2"}
]
set_return(None, side_effect=expected_docs)
docs = []
async for doc in container_client.query_items("SELECT * FROM c"):
docs.append(doc)
assert docs == expected_docs
Service Bus
Message Operations
async def test_send_message(sbus):
message = "test message"
await sbus.send_message(message)
assert message in sbus.sent_messages
async def test_schedule_message(managed_sbus):
await managed_sbus.send_message("scheduled message", delay=300)
# Verify scheduled message call
managed_sbus._sender.schedule_messages.assert_called_once()
Event Hub
Event Publishing
async def test_send_event(mockehub):
from aio_azure_clients_toolbox.clients.eventhub import Eventhub
client = Eventhub("namespace", "hub", lambda: mock.AsyncMock())
await client.send_event("test event")
mockehub.add.assert_called_once_with("test event")
mockehub.send_batch.assert_called_once()
